Het probleem met de verwerking van VCF-bijlagen in Power Automate oplossen met SharePoint Online

Het probleem met de verwerking van VCF-bijlagen in Power Automate oplossen met SharePoint Online
SharePoint

Het aanpakken van uitdagingen op het gebied van VCF-bijlagen in Power Automate-workflows

Bij het automatiseren van processen met Power Automate, vooral als het gaat om e-mailbeheer en SharePoint Online-integratie, komen gebruikers vaak verschillende uitdagingen tegen. Een specifiek probleem dat naar voren is gekomen betreft de trigger "Wanneer er een nieuwe e-mail binnenkomt (V3)", een cruciaal onderdeel in workflows die zijn ontworpen om informatie uit inkomende e-mails te extraheren en te gebruiken. Deze functionaliteit maakt doorgaans het extraheren van gebruikersnamen uit de onderwerpregels van e-mails mogelijk, zoals de regels die zijn opgemaakt als 'Welkomnaam, achternaam', en het opnemen van deze namen in een SharePoint-lijst. Dit proces is niet alleen efficiënt, maar stroomlijnt ook het beheer en de organisatie van gebruikersgegevens voor verdere verwerking of archivering.

Hoewel de workflow naadloos samenwerkt met standaard Outlook-bijlagen, stuit het echter op een probleem bij het omgaan met VCF-bestanden (vCard). Ondanks dat de e-mail aan alle noodzakelijke criteria voldoet – correcte opmaak van de onderwerpregel en de aanwezigheid van een bijlage – worden SharePoint-lijsten niet bijgewerkt met informatie uit e-mails met VCF-bijlagen. Deze discrepantie roept vragen op over de compatibiliteit van de e-mailtrigger van Power Automate met verschillende bestandsindelingen en of dit probleem een ​​beperking is van de functie "Wanneer een nieuwe e-mail binnenkomt (V3)" zelf. Het identificeren van de oorzaak van dit probleem is essentieel voor gebruikers die vertrouwen op Power Automate om de informatiestroom naadloos tussen e-mail en SharePoint Online te beheren.

Commando Beschrijving
Connect-PnPOnline Maakt verbinding met de SharePoint Online-site om de bewerkingen te starten.
Add-PnPListItem Voegt een nieuw item toe aan een opgegeven lijst in SharePoint.
Disconnect-PnPOnline Verbreekt de huidige sessie van de SharePoint Online-site.
def Definieert een functie in Python (gebruikt als pseudocode voor Azure Function).
if Evalueert een voorwaarde en voert een codeblok uit als de voorwaarde True is.

Inzicht in de uitdagingen op het gebied van VCF-bijlagen bij e-mailautomatisering

VCF-bestanden, bekend om het opslaan van contactgegevens, vormen een unieke uitdaging in geautomatiseerde workflows, vooral in scenario's met Power Automate en SharePoint Online. De oorzaak van het probleem ligt niet per se in het proces van het detecteren van e-mailbijlagen, maar in de specifieke verwerking en verwerking van VCF-bestanden binnen deze systemen. Hoewel Power Automate een verscheidenheid aan bijlagetypen efficiënt beheert via de trigger "Wanneer een nieuwe e-mail binnenkomt (V3)", worden VCF-bestanden vaak niet met hetzelfde nauwkeurigheidsniveau verwerkt. Deze discrepantie kan voortkomen uit de unieke inhoudsstructuur en metagegevens van het VCF-formaat, die aanzienlijk verschillen van meer gebruikelijke bestandstypen zoals DOCX of PDF. De integratie van Power Automate met SharePoint Online maakt de situatie nog ingewikkelder, omdat de directe overdracht van gegevens uit VCF-bestanden naar SharePoint-lijsten een nauwkeurige parsering en toewijzing van VCF-inhoud aan de gegevensvelden van SharePoint vereist.

Deze uitdaging onderstreept de noodzaak van geavanceerde aanpassingen of alternatieve oplossingen binnen Power Automate-workflows om VCF-bijlagen mogelijk te maken. Mogelijke oplossingen kunnen de ontwikkeling van aangepaste connectoren of scripts omvatten die VCF-bestanden kunnen parseren en de benodigde informatie kunnen extraheren voordat SharePoint-lijsten worden bijgewerkt. Een dergelijke aanpassing zou niet alleen de huidige beperkingen oplossen, maar ook de flexibiliteit en mogelijkheden van Power Automate vergroten om een ​​breder scala aan bestandstypen te verwerken. Bovendien kan het verkennen van tools of services van derden die gespecialiseerd zijn in de verwerking van e-mailbijlagen een tussenoplossing bieden terwijl permanente oplossingen worden ontwikkeld. Het aanpakken van het VCF-bijlageprobleem is van cruciaal belang voor organisaties die afhankelijk zijn van geautomatiseerde workflows om communicatie- en gegevensbeheerprocessen te stroomlijnen, vooral als het gaat om contactinformatie die vaak in de vorm van VCF-bestanden komt.

Verbetering van SharePoint Online-lijstupdates voor VCF-bijlagen

PowerShell voor SharePoint-bewerkingen

# PowerShell script to update SharePoint list
$siteURL = "YourSharePointSiteURL"
$listName = "YourListName"
$userName = "EmailSubjectUserName"
$userSurname = "EmailSubjectUserSurname"
$attachmentType = "VCF"
# Connect to SharePoint Online
Connect-PnPOnline -Url $siteURL -UseWebLogin
# Add an item to the list
Add-PnPListItem -List $listName -Values @{"Title" = "$userName $userSurname"; "AttachmentType" = $attachmentType}
# Disconnect the session
Disconnect-PnPOnline

Aangepaste verwerking van e-mailbijlagen voor Power Automate

Pseudocode voor Azure-functie-integratie

# Pseudo-code for Azure Function to process email attachments
def process_email_attachments(email):
    attachment = email.get_attachment()
    if attachment.file_type == "VCF":
        return True
    else:
        return False
# Trigger SharePoint list update if attachment is VCF
def update_sharepoint_list(email):
    if process_email_attachments(email):
        # Logic to call PowerShell script or SharePoint API
        update_list = True
    else:
        update_list = False
# Sample email object
email = {"subject": "Welcome name surname", "attachment": {"file_type": "VCF"}}
# Update SharePoint list based on email attachment type
update_sharepoint_list(email)

Vooruitgang boeken via VCF-bestandsintegratie in Power Automate en SharePoint

Als we dieper ingaan op de complexiteit van het integreren van VCF-bestanden binnen Power Automate in SharePoint Online-workflows, ontstaat er een genuanceerd landschap van technische uitdagingen en innovatieve oplossingen. VCF, of Virtual Contact File, is een standaard bestandsformaat voor het opslaan van contactgegevens, die meerdere gegevenspunten kunnen bevatten, zoals namen, telefoonnummers, e-mailadressen en zelfs foto's. De essentie van het integreren van deze bestanden in geautomatiseerde workflows ligt in hun niet-binaire aard en de gestructureerde gegevens die ze bevatten. In tegenstelling tot eenvoudige bestandstypen bevatten VCF-bestanden gedetailleerde contactgegevens die moeten worden geparseerd en geïnterpreteerd om effectief te kunnen worden gebruikt in databases of lijsten zoals die in SharePoint Online.

Deze complexiteit vereist de ontwikkeling van gespecialiseerde parseermechanismen binnen Power Automate-workflows of het gebruik van connectoren van derden die VCF-gegevens kunnen interpreteren. Het uiteindelijke doel is om de extractie van relevante contactgegevens uit VCF-bestanden te automatiseren en deze toe te wijzen aan SharePoint-lijsten, waardoor het gegevensbeheer en de toegankelijkheid worden verbeterd. Een dergelijke integratie stroomlijnt niet alleen het proces van het verwerken van e-mailbijlagen in workflows, maar verrijkt ook de SharePoint-omgeving met waardevolle contactinformatie, waardoor nieuwe wegen worden geopend voor samenwerking en communicatie binnen organisaties.

Veelgestelde vragen over de integratie van VCF-bijlagen in Power Automate

  1. Vraag: Kan Power Automate VCF-bestandsbijlagen rechtstreeks verwerken?
  2. Antwoord: Power Automate kan VCF-bestandsbijlagen verwerken, maar hiervoor zijn mogelijk aangepaste oplossingen of connectoren van derden nodig voor het parseren en verwerken.
  3. Vraag: Waarom werken VCF-bijlagen mijn SharePoint-lijst niet automatisch bij?
  4. Antwoord: Dit probleem komt meestal voort uit de behoefte aan een aangepast parseermechanisme om gegevens uit VCF-bestanden te extraheren voordat SharePoint-lijsten worden bijgewerkt.
  5. Vraag: Zijn er kant-en-klare oplossingen voor het integreren van VCF-bestanden in SharePoint-lijsten?
  6. Antwoord: Hoewel Power Automate uitgebreide connectiviteit biedt, kan voor specifieke VCF-naar-SharePoint-integratie aangepaste ontwikkeling of oplossingen van derden nodig zijn.
  7. Vraag: Kunnen VCF-contactgegevens rechtstreeks naar SharePoint-kolommen worden geëxtraheerd?
  8. Antwoord: Ja, maar hiervoor is een parseermechanisme nodig om VCF-gegevensvelden nauwkeurig toe te wijzen aan SharePoint-kolommen.
  9. Vraag: Is het mogelijk om het hele proces te automatiseren, van het ontvangen van een VCF-bijlage tot het bijwerken van een SharePoint-lijst?
  10. Antwoord: Ja, met de juiste configuratie met Power Automate, mogelijk Azure Functions voor aangepaste logica en SharePoint, kan het proces worden geautomatiseerd.

Verbetering van de workflow-integratie voor efficiënt gegevensbeheer

De reis door het oplossen van de complexiteit van het integreren van VCF-bestandsbijlagen in Power Automate om SharePoint Online-lijsten bij te werken, benadrukt een aanzienlijke leercurve en mogelijkheden voor innovatie. Deze verkenning heeft licht geworpen op het belang van op maat gemaakte oplossingen of tools van derden om de leemte in de huidige automatiseringsmogelijkheden op te vullen. Het begrijpen van het unieke formaat van VCF-bestanden en de noodzaak van gespecialiseerde parsering om hun gegevens te extraheren en te gebruiken, is van cruciaal belang. Het onderstreept het evoluerende karakter van tools voor workflowautomatisering en de noodzaak van voortdurende aanpassing om aan de uiteenlopende behoeften van de organisatie te voldoen. Voor bedrijven die afhankelijk zijn van SharePoint voor gegevensbeheer en Power Automate voor workflowautomatisering, biedt deze situatie een kans om hun processen verder te verbeteren. Het ontwikkelen of adopteren van oplossingen die deze technische hiaten overbruggen, zal niet alleen de huidige uitdagingen oplossen, maar ook de weg vrijmaken voor meer geavanceerde automatiseringsmogelijkheden in de toekomst. De vooruitgang in het omgaan met verschillende typen bijlagen, waaronder VCF-bestanden, zal ongetwijfeld bijdragen aan efficiëntere, flexibelere en krachtigere automatiseringsecosystemen.